catonlap · 19/04/2014 11:21

If it goes on for longer than 7 days then you should contact the GP about arranging a stool sample.

That is of course assuming he remains well in himself as your post suggests. If he's happy, alert and drinking plenty then it's fine to leave it 7 days before consulting GP about further investigation. If he becomes poorly in himself - then he should be seen sooner.
